How many states can you catch ferry to BLOCK island?

You can catch a ferry to Block Island from two states: Rhode Island and Connecticut. Ferries typically depart from Point Judith and Newport in Rhode Island, as well as from New London in Connecticut. These routes provide access to the island, which is a popular destination for visitors.


What is Rhode Island major airports?

The airports are T.F. Greene, North Central, Newport, Westerly, and Block Island. The major one is T.F. Greene formerly known as Hillsgrove
